Ittierre appoints Massimo Suppancig as director general

Published
May 20, 2009


Massimo Suppancig
On the road to recovery, Ittierre S.p.A, represented by its three administrators – Stanislao Chimenti, Andrea Ciccoli and Roberto Spada, have named Massimo Suppancig as director general.

Massimo Suppancig, 49, held the post of administrator posted to the Italian handbag brand Valextra between 2003 and 2007. Notably, he contributed to this brand’s relaunch and increase in turnover. Mr Suppancig has also worked at Benetton, the Gruppo Finanziaro Tessile, Escada and at Hugo Boss Italy.

“The appointment of Massimo Suppancig is important for Ittierre”, stated the administrators. “It confirms the determination that we have to continue to recovery of this company”.

It has been more than three months since the production company of the IT Holding group (which holds the licences for Just Cavalli, Galliano, C’n’c and Versace Jeans) was placed under administration in an exceptional procedure by the Italian economic development minister. This was done in order to prop the company up, with the aim of preserving the jobs of its 772 employees.

The arrival of Massimo Suppancig is confirmation that the group want to relaunch the business, now knowing that the trio of administrators have obtained a credit line of €30 million and that the licence for Just Cavalli has been extended to run until 2014.
